Evaporation

The process in the water cycle where liquid water changes into water vapor, caused by energy from the Sun.

2
New cards

Transpiration

The process in which plants release water vapor into the atmosphere.

3
New cards

Precipitation

Water falling from the atmosphere to Earth's surface as rain, snow, sleet, or hail.

4
New cards

Infiltration

The process by which water enters and moves through the soil.

5
New cards

Runoff

Water that flows across the land surface into rivers, lakes, and oceans.

6
New cards

Groundwater

Water stored underground within soil and rock formations.

7
New cards

Watershed

An area of land where all rain and snowmelt drain into a common body of water, with boundaries determined by elevation.

8
New cards

Primary Productivity

The rate at which producers convert solar energy into glucose via photosynthesis, measured in units like Kcal/m2/year\text{Kcal/m}^2/\text{year}.

9
New cards

Gross Primary Production (GPPGPP)

The total energy stored from photosynthesis by producers before any energy is used for respiration.

10
New cards

Respiration (RR)

The cellular energy used by producers to live and grow.

11
New cards

Net Primary Production (NPPNPP)

The energy stored as biomass that can be passed on to consumers, calculated using the formula NPP=GPPRNPP = GPP - R.

Nitrogen Fixation

The first step of the nitrogen cycle where nitrogen-fixing bacteria in soil or plant roots convert atmospheric nitrogen (N2N_2) into ammonium (NH3NH_3 / NH4NH_4) that organisms can use.

19
New cards

Nitrification

The step in the nitrogen cycle where soil bacteria convert ammonium into nitrites (NO2NO_2) and then nitrates (NO3NO_3).

20
New cards

Assimilation (Nitrogen Cycle)

The process by which plants absorb nitrate (NO3NO_3) through their roots to produce proteins and nucleic acids, which animals then obtain by eating plants.

21
New cards

Ammonification

The process where decomposers break down dead organisms and waste, restoring usable nitrogen (NH3NH_3 / NH4NH_4) into the soil.

22
New cards

Denitrification

The final step of the nitrogen cycle where bacteria convert nitrate (NO3NO_3) back into atmospheric nitrogen gas (N2N_2).

Lotic Systems

Flowing freshwater ecosystems such as rivers and streams, where turbulence increases dissolved oxygen levels.

28
New cards

Lentic Systems

Standing freshwater ecosystems such as ponds and lakes.

29
New cards

Littoral Zone

The shallow freshwater lake zone near the shore characterized by high light availability and high Net Primary Productivity (NPPNPP).

30
New cards

Limnetic Zone

The open surface water zone of a lake where light penetrates.

31
New cards

Benthic Zone

The bottom zone of a body of water receiving little to low light.

32
New cards

Oligotrophic Lake

A deep, clear lake characterized by low nutrient levels and low primary productivity.

33
New cards

Eutrophic Lake

A shallow, often less clear lake characterized by high nutrient levels and high primary productivity.

34
New cards

Estuary

A coastal aquatic biome where freshwater meets saltwater, creating brackish water with high nutrients, productivity, and biodiversity.

35
New cards

Photic Zone

The upper layer of ocean water where sufficient sunlight penetrates to allow photosynthesis.

36
New cards

Aphotic Zone

Deeper ocean water where no sunlight reaches, preventing photosynthesis.

37
New cards

Coastal Upwelling

An ocean process where wind pushes surface water away, causing cold, nutrient-rich deep water to rise to the photic zone, increasing NPPNPP and biodiversity.
